Sam and Beth visited the Three Pigeons plot to weed and water - it had become rather overgrown with persistent mint determined to take over what space there was, along with various other weeds. Beth set to work on this, while Sam did a sterling job of watering, in particular soaking the acers and those recently planted by the different benches on the path. A surprise collection of stinging nettles made the task a little interesting - but was swiftly dealt with. Some of the picked mint was taken home for planting (Sam) and mojitos (Beth - medicinal for the stings...)
